Interest rates can vary significantly from lender to lender, so it's wise to compare offers. For example, if one lender offers a 15% interest rate and another offers 25%, even a small loan can lead to considerable differences in repayment amounts. Always ask for the Annual Percentage Rate (APR) to gain a clearer picture of the costs involved.

How Title Loans Work for Bad Credit Title loans are secured loans where borrowers use their vehicle title as collateral. The loan amount is typically based on the vehicle's value. The process is straightforward: a borrower submits their vehicle title, along with proof of income and identification, to a lender.

Navigating Fees and Interest Rates Understanding the fees and interest rates associated with title loans is vital to avoid unexpected financial burdens. Lenders may charge various fees, including origination fees, late payment fees, and in some cases, prepayment penalties. Before signing an agreement, read the fine print carefully and ask the lender to clarify any terms that are unclear.
